Output de6dc39e6345b48d02d54cae68adeed51982ed0cdf88501a134c1b58dcc06f4e:0

value
1509992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34cba8054a970283d3bb72ac7267399440818755 OP_EQUAL
address
36WB2osHFfEHwnLQYSV53AXrttpRqEfhrP
transaction
de6dc39e6345b48d02d54cae68adeed51982ed0cdf88501a134c1b58dcc06f4e
spent
true